How you become one varies far more by country than what one does. This is the UK route. Most people take one of these ways in; the right one depends on where you're starting from.
- 1
Senior Travel Sales Executive
3-5 years in a senior individual contributor role.Skills to master
- Consistently exceeding high individual targets, mentoring junior colleagues, leading complex client accounts, and demonstrating strong commercial acumen beyond just your own sales.
You're ready to move on when
- You're the go-to person for complex client issues or tricky negotiations.
- You've informally mentored 2-3 junior executives who have shown significant improvement.
- You've taken the lead on a significant project or initiative that impacted the wider sales team.
- You're actively contributing to sales strategy discussions, not just executing them.
- 2
Key Account Director / Team Lead (Sales)
2-4 years managing a portfolio of strategic accounts or a small team.Skills to master
- Building deep, long-term relationships with high-value clients, managing a small team's performance, strategic account planning, and influencing internal stakeholders.
You're ready to move on when
- You've successfully grown our top 5-10 accounts significantly year-on-year.
- You've directly supervised or led a small team to achieve their collective targets.
- You're regularly presenting strategic account plans to senior leadership.
- You've taken ownership of resolving complex client issues that impact significant revenue.
- 3
Business Development Manager (Travel Sector)
4-6 years focused on identifying and securing new business opportunities.Skills to master
- Market research, lead generation, new client acquisition strategy, building pipelines from scratch, and strong negotiation skills for initial contracts.
You're ready to move on when
- You've successfully opened up significant new revenue streams or market segments.
- You're an expert at identifying and qualifying high-potential new business leads.
- You're comfortable presenting our value proposition to C-suite level prospects.
- You've built and managed a strong new business pipeline that consistently converts.
